What People Value Here
Education & Youth Programs
Crawford County supports students from early childhood through graduation with strong public schools, youth enrichment programs, and community-led initiatives. Parents will find personalized learning environments, caring educators, and opportunities for involvement.

Healthcare & Senior Services
Residents have access to primary care, specialty providers, emergency services, and senior support resources. With clinics throughout the county and larger regional hospitals nearby, families benefit from both quality and convenience.

Parks, Trails & River Life
The Driftless landscape offers endless outdoor opportunities — bluffs, river valleys, trails, parks, campgrounds, and protected natural areas. Whether you're an outdoor athlete or a weekend explorer, there’s always something to do outside.

Community Life
Crawford County’s culture shines through its festivals, farmers markets, live music, art shows, and historic experiences. Local organizations and volunteers bring the region together with events that celebrate heritage, creativity, and community spirit.
